1. How to deal with newly bought tulipsAfter buying tulip bulbs, you need to observe the growth of the bulbs to ensure good future growth. Its bulbs must be good, because the bulbs are the basis for its growth and flowering. The bulbs are required to be full and complete, and it is best if there is no damage on the surface. The bulbs should be above 12 cm. If they are too small, they may not bloom later. It is best to disinfect the bulbs before planting them. Just soak them in carbendazim for about 20 minutes. 2. How to deal with specific details1. Soil: Choose suitable flower pots and soil for planting. Clay pots are more breathable. The soil should be loose and breathable. You can mix peat soil with some river sand, with a ratio of 2:1 being the best. This way the soil is not only breathable but also nutritious. When planting the bulbs, gently compact the soil around them. 2. Environment: When you first buy tulips, you need to let them adapt to the environment at home, disinfect them and plant them. It needs to be placed in a sunny place for a while to allow it to adapt. Water less and do not fertilize. Be sure to wait until it starts to resume growth before carrying out daily regular maintenance. 3. Watering: When adapting to the environment, you don’t need to water too much. Water once every 4 to 6 days on average to keep the soil slightly moist. Wait until the leaves begin to stretch, then water normally, and water as soon as the soil is dry. 4. Fertilization: No fertilization is needed when planting in pots. When some leaves grow, you can start fertilizing. Do not apply a large amount of fertilizer at one time, as this may easily burn its roots. You can use some fertilizer cakes or decomposed fertilizer, and fertilize again after flower buds appear. |
